Washington & Old Dominion Railroad covered the
railroad's corporate history, construction, and operation. This
second volume expands the coverage with a geographic focus on four
locations: Rosslyn, Great Falls, Leesburg, and Purcellville. The images
within offer a look at the railroad's feed and grain business, railfan-type
views of equipment, and a visual record of methods used to maintain
the right-of-way and place equipment back on the tracks. Additionally,
this work offers a history of the conversion of the right-of-way into the
very popular Washington & Old Dominion Railroad Regional Park.
Learn about the history of mills and their place in the local economy.
See how the Burro crane was a jack of all trades. Look under the hood
and inside the cab to imagine what it was like to be an engineer on
one of the railroad's Baldwin-Westinghouse electric freight locomotives.
